我的Chrome扩展程序决定是否根据JSON白名单激活。目前使用以下函数检索此文件。我想做的是,将文件存储一段时间,假设是1天,即使浏览器同时关闭也是如此。这样做的最佳方式是什么?
请求代码:
jQuery.getJSON( "https://www.example.com/whitelist.json" ) //cache this file
.done(function( data ) {
jQuery.each(data.configs, function(key, val) {
showMenu();
return
})
})
.fail(function( jqxhr, textStatus, error ) {
var err = textStatus + ", " + error;
console.log( "Request Failed: " + err );
});
答案 0 :(得分:-1)
使用session_set_cookie_parameters()在会话开始前为会话cookie提供非零生命周期,或将session.cookie_lifetime设置为非零。 你可以尝试这个选项.. 一切顺利。